Understanding Pre-Approval vs. Pre-Qualification:

 

Pre-Approval vs. Pre-Qualification is there a difference?
Yes, there is a big difference between “Pre-Approval” and “Pre-Qualification”.

Pre-Qualification
Mortgage Prequalification is a calculation of the amount of home a buyer can afford. It is based on the information that is provided by the borrower with no credit inquiry, asset or income verification. This can be done fairly quickly by a mortgage professional.

Pre-Approval
Loan Pre-approval is a much more involved than a simple Pre-qualification. A Pre-Approval is generated from your lender and requires a review of your credit report, pay stubs, assets, liabilities and so fourth. The Pre-Approval also provides information to the Real Estate Agent as to the amount of home a buyer can afford. Most sellers prefer to see a Pre-Approved buyer when reviewing any offers.

 

 

The Benefits of using a Mortgage Broker
A loan program, which best suits a particular borrower, may not always  be evident when a borrower makes loan application. Often a loan program which at first looks as if it is a good match may not be practical as the loan is processed and additional information about the borrower and/or property is received. Lender loan programs and the rates inherent in each program often change daily. Using a Mortgage Broker allows the consumer the opportunity to go to a different lender if the original program, or its rates and/or fees have changed. A Mortgage Broker represents their client by utilizing a multitude of lenders. Mortgage Brokers offer their clients flexibility through a variety of loan programs than those which are offered through a traditional bank.
